Pagini recente » Cod sursa (job #329761) | Cod sursa (job #2471869) | Cod sursa (job #1828595) | Cod sursa (job #2090345) | Cod sursa (job #1660593)
#include <iostream>
#include <fstream>
using namespace std;
int v[101];
int a[101];
int main ()
{ ifstream cin ("submultimi.in");
ofstream cout ("submultimi.out");
int n,i,j,t=1,p;
cin >> n;
v[n]=1;
for (i=1;i<=n;i++)
{
t=t*2;
}
for (i=1;i<=t-1;i++)
{
for (p=1;p<=n;p++)
if (v[p]==1) cout <<p << " ";
cout << "\n";
for (j=n;j>=1;j--)
{
if (v[j]==0)
{
v[j]=1;
break;
}
else
{
v[j]=0;
}
}
}
return 0;
}